Kingston University has four campuses across Kingston upon Thames and south-west London. The main Penrhyn Road campus is in Kingston town centre (KT1), home to most taught programmes. Knights Park in Kingston (KT1) is dedicated to art, architecture and design. Kingston Hill (KT2) houses education, social sciences and nursing. Roehampton Vale (SW15) is home to engineering, aerospace and the automotive programme. Student accommodation is primarily in Surbiton (KT6) at Seething Wells and John Galsworthy House, and on Kingston Hill at Clayhill. We collect from all named Kingston halls and from private student houses across the KT1, KT2 and KT6 postcode areas.
Seething Wells is one of the most architecturally distinctive student accommodation addresses in south-west London. The site is a Victorian water filtration works on the Thames in Surbiton, converted into student accommodation, a striking red-brick industrial complex that is instantly recognisable to anyone who has studied at Kingston. It is approximately 25 miles from our Grays facility, making it one of the closer south-west London university addresses to us. John Galsworthy House is also in Surbiton (KT6), approximately the same distance. Our collection team covers KT1, KT2 and KT6 Monday to Sunday throughout May, June and July.

You book your storage unit online, choose the size you need and select a collection date. Our own team arrives at your address on the agreed day, whether that is a university managed hall of residence, a private student house or a shared flat. One hour of loading time is included in all packages, and our team will load everything into the vehicle for you so there is no heavy lifting involved. Your belongings are then transported directly to our secure, CCTV monitored and alarmed facility in Grays, Essex, where they are stored for the duration of your package. When you are ready to have your belongings back, you contact your move coordinator and we arrange delivery to any UK address or internationally. The entire process from booking to collection can be arranged within 48 hours in most cases.
Our summer packages run for 16 weeks from May to September and include collection from your door. A small student room package covering 15 sq ft costs £249 for three months, which works out at £15.56 per week. A large student room package covering 35 sq ft costs £399, equivalent to £24.94 per week. A full one-bedroom flat package at 70 sq ft costs £549, and a two-bedroom or house share package at 105 sq ft costs £699. All prices include collection from your door at the address you provide. After the initial three months, your storage continues at the same lower package rate rather than the standard pay as you go rate, so there is no price jump if you need to store for longer.
Yes. When you add up three months of standard pay as you go self-storage plus a separate collection service, the total cost is consistently higher than our packages. For a small student room, the comparable cost without our package is around £345, meaning our package saves you £96. For a large student room the saving is £138, for a one-bedroom flat it is £204 and for a house share it is £275. The saving exists because we include collection in the package price rather than charging it separately. We do this because the whole point of student storage is that you should not need to organise a van or make multiple trips to a storage unit at the end of term.

Self storage means you transport your belongings to our facility yourself and can access them during our opening hours. Collection and delivery storage means we collect your belongings from your address, store them in our facility and deliver them back when you need them. You do not visit the facility at all. For most students, collection and delivery storage is the right choice because it removes the need to hire a van, borrow a car or make multiple journeys at the end of term. Our summer packages use the collection and delivery model. We also offer indoor self storage units at our Grays, Essex facility for students who prefer drive-up access or who need to retrieve items during the summer.

Your belongings are held in our own CCTV monitored, alarmed and secure facility in Grays, Essex. We recommend that you check your own contents insurance policy, as many policies cover belongings in storage as standard or for a small additional premium. Some student bank accounts and university accommodation packages also include contents cover that extends to off-site storage. If you need specific storage insurance and your existing policy does not cover it, your move coordinator can advise on options when you book. Please do not assume coverage without checking your policy documents, as the terms vary between providers.
